Bangkok is a year-round destination, though most visitors arrive Nov–Feb when the weather is warm and relatively dry. Temperatures rise Mar–May, with rainy season May–Nov. Major festivals include the celebrations for Songkran/Thai New Year (Apr) and Loi Krathong (Nov), the “festival of lights” that sees thousands of tiny candles launched in floats along the river. Dec 5 marks the late King Bhumibol Adulyadej’s Birthday as well as National Day and National Father’s Day.
